About Andrea Hricko

Andrea Hricko is a scholar working on Transportation, Speech and Hearing and Health, Toxicology and Mutagenesis, having authored 16 papers that have together received 379 indexed citations. Recurring topics across this work include Air Quality and Health Impacts (5 papers), Noise Effects and Management (4 papers) and Urban Transport and Accessibility (3 papers). The work is most often cited by research in Health, Toxicology and Mutagenesis (227 citations), Speech and Hearing (73 citations) and Transportation (51 citations). Andrea Hricko has collaborated with scholars based in United States and Spain. Frequent co-authors include Rob McConnell, Frank D. Gilliland, Fred Lurmann, Nino Künzli, John Peters, Ed Avol, Laura Pérez, Steven D. Mittelman, Theresa M. Bastain and Jill Johnston. Their work appears in journals such as American Journal of Public Health, Environmental Health Perspectives and International Journal of Environmental Research and Public Health.
